Core Components of Effective SEO Services
Quality SEO is diverse. Even a budget-conscious campaign should resolve several pillars to be effective. Any credible UK provider offering affordable packages ought to include the following components:
1. Technical SEO Audit
The foundation of any project is a technical audit. This makes sure that the site is crawlable and indexable. It involves repairing broken links, improving website speed, and making sure the site is mobile-friendly-- a critical element offered that a substantial portion of UK web traffic happens on handheld devices.
2. Keyword Research and Strategy
Determining what prospective clients are browsing for is crucial. Affordable services focus on "long-tail" keywords-- highly specific phrases that may have lower search volume but much higher intent and lower competition.
3. On-Page Optimization
This includes refining individual pages to rank greater. It consists of enhancing meta titles, descriptions, header tags (H1-H6), and image alt text.
4. Material Creation
Search engines focus on premium, pertinent material. Affordable SEO typically focuses on consistent article or landing page updates that respond to customer questions and develop the brand name as an authority in its specific niche.
5. Regional SEO
For many UK companies, the local market is the most crucial. This includes optimizing the Google Business Profile (previously Google My Business) and making sure the organization appears in local "Map Pack" outcomes.
Comparing SEO Service Providers in the UK
When looking for affordable alternatives, companies typically choose in between freelancers, small shop companies, or bigger automated platforms.
| Function | Freelancers | Store SEO Agencies | Large Full-Service Agencies |
|---|---|---|---|
| Typical Monthly Cost | ₤ 300-- ₤ 800 | ₤ 750-- ₤ 2,500 | ₤ 3,000+ |
| Personalization | Very High | High | Moderate/Low |
| Proficiency Range | Specialized | Broad/Team-based | Extensive |
| Speed of Communication | Variable | Dependable | Structured/Slow |
| Best For | Micro-businesses & & Soloists | SMEs looking for development | National/Global Brands |

Typical Pricing Models for SEO in the UK
Understanding how SEO is billed assists organizations spending plan successfully. A lot of UK suppliers offer among the following structures:
| Pricing Model | Description | Estimated Price Range |
|---|---|---|
| Month-to-month Retainer | A fixed charge for ongoing work (most common). | ₤ 500-- ₤ 2,000 each month |
| Project-Based | A one-off cost for a specific job (e.g., a technical audit). | ₤ 400-- ₤ 2,500 per job |
| Hourly Rate | Paying for the expert's time. | ₤ 50-- ₤ 150 per hour |
Red Flags to Avoid When Seeking Low-Cost SEO
While searching for affordable services, it is vital to remain watchful. Particular pledges are indicative of poor-quality services that could hurt a site's reputation.
- Surefire Rankings: No one can ensure a # 1 area on Google because search algorithms change constantly.
- Instant Results: SEO is a marathon, not a sprint. Any provider promising outcomes within days is most likely utilizing "black-hat" tactics that will lead to a Google penalty.
- Lack of Transparency: If a provider can not discuss their procedure or declines to supply regular monthly reports, they need to be avoided.
- Automated Link Building: Cheap services typically buy thousands of low-grade links. This is a violation of online search engine standards and can lead to a site being de-indexed.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. The length of time does it take to see arise from affordable SEO?
Usually, it takes in between 3 to 6 months to see considerable improvements in rankings and traffic. SEO is a progressive process that involves structure authority and trust with search engines.
2. Can I do SEO myself to conserve cash?
Yes, fundamental SEO can be dealt with internal. However, it is time-consuming and requires a steep knowing curve. Many companies discover that working with an affordable expert enables them to focus on their core operations while ensuring the SEO is done correctly.
3. Does "affordable" suggest the quality will be lower?
Not necessarily. Lots of smaller companies or freelancers have lower overheads than large London-based companies, permitting them to provide the very same level of knowledge at a more accessible price point.
4. Is SEO still relevant in 2024?
Absolutely. Organic search stays one of the main methods consumers discover product or services. In truth, as social networks ends up being more fragmented and paid advertising costs increase, organic SEO continues to offer one of the highest ROIs in digital marketing.
5. What is the distinction between SEO and PPC?
SEO focuses on making traffic through unpaid, natural results. PPC (Pay-Per-Click) involves spending for ads to appear at the top of search engine result. While PPC offers instantaneous presence, SEO offers long-lasting value that doesn't vanish the minute you stop spending for advertisements.
